I tried a soil test kit put out by McKenzie seeds. It has 4 vials with indicators and you fill the soil solution to a set level and shake. When the colour develops you compare it to a chart. While not as precise as a lab test I was impressed with the results for general use and it only cost a couple of dollars. And based on the results with a pH of about 7.8 please don'ttell me to add lime. What else do you expect when the farm is on a limestone hill.
